    Not sure how long it's been like this due to the summer months but there seems to be a disconnect with my Heatlink and Thermostat.
    The thermostat shows no errors and all looks good in terms of connection, the thermostat turns to orange and tries to engage the heating but the Heatlink does nothing. It just stays as green but doesn't kick the heating on.
    Manually it works fine from the Heatlink.
    I've reset the Heatlink and still the same.
    Any suggestions, Google gives too many US based results.

    I googled it for you.. Heat link isnt part of the nest setup in the US so you shouldn't get US results if you write nest "heat link" with heat link in quotes.

    Restart the Heat Link by pressing and holding the button on the front of the Heat Link. Press and hold the button for 10 seconds until the light goes out. The status light will then turn green once it is connected to your thermostat.
